Crystal Adventures is a dive club founded by Scuba Enthusiasts in Vancouver area. We focus on serving the needs of scuba training and dive travels to people around Vancouver. At Crystal Adventures, we offer both recreational and professional level PADI dive trainings, from learn-to-dive as a scuba diver to advanced, specialty, rescue and master scuba diver; from divemaster to open water scuba instructor. We specialize in offering private and small group classes at an affordable price so you will get enough personal attention.

PADI Open Water Diver Course

Costs: $400.00 (Includes course materials and all equipment for the class)

If you’ve always wondered what lies beneath the surface, now’s the time to find out. Start the journey of a lifetime with the PADI Open Water Diver course. It will change you forever.

In the PADI Open Water Diver course, your PADI Instructor takes you through the basics of learning how to scuba dive. You start in a pool or pool-like conditions and progress to the open water (ocean, lake, quarry, etc.) getting the background knowledge along the way.

At your own pace, you can complete the knowledge development portion of the PADI Open Water Diver course online with PADI eLearning.

Earning your PADI Open Water Diver certification is just the beginning. As a certified diver, fabulous dive destinations, exciting people, unparalleled adventure and uncommon tranquility await you. And, as you continue your adventure and gain experience through higher training levels, your opportunities expand.

Prerequisites: 10 for Junior Open Water Diver and 15 for Open Water Diver. Good health, reasonable fitness and comfort in the water, RSTC Medical Form .

Number of Dives: Five Confined Water Dives and Four Open Water Dives
Knowledge Development: Five sessions

Materials You’ll Need: PADI Open Water Crew-Pak, PADI Open Water Video or DVD, Log Book.
Equipment you’ll use during the course includes: mask, fins, snorkel, tank, regulator, buoyancy compensator, submersible pressure gauge and exposure protection as required by the local environment.
